Polish director Piotr Trzaskalski's Edi (2002) chronicles the life of the title character (Henryk Golebiewski) as a homeless scrap collector. A pair of tough-guy brothers (Jacek Lenartowicz and Grzegorz Stelmaszewski) hire Edi to look after their teenage sister (Aleksandra Kisio), who's running a bit too wild for their liking. When the girl gets pregnant, she claims Edi is the father, and the results are unexpected in this moving, grittily realistic drama.
